Give an account of the human male reproductive system.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

Human male reproductive system It consists of various glands, ducts and supporting structures. The structures present in this system are either paired or unpaired.
Testes are primary sex organs, posterior to the penis within the scrotum, produce spermatozoa and testosterone.
Seminal vesicles are club-shaped glands posterior to prostate, secrete alkaline fluid containing nutrients, fructose and prostaglandins. Scrotum is the pouch of skin, posterior to the penis, encloses and protects testes.
Penis is the unpaired organ, anterior to the scrotum and attached to pubis, conveys urine to outside of body.
Prostate gland and Cowper.s gland secrete fluids which neutralise acidic environment of vagina and lubricate urethra and penis, respectively."
